Over the past 25 years, there have been 87 property sales recorded in the WS7 9QG postcode area. The highest sale price reached £550,000, while the most recent sale was for a detached house sold in July 2024 for £470,000.
The estimated average property value in WS7 9QG currently stands at £579,890, which is approximately 103% higher than the city average, indicating a potentially more desirable or in-demand location.
In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£3,954.
Property prices in WS7 9QG have risen by 7.8% over the past year , with a total increase of 31.8% over the past five years, and a long-term rise of 59.2% over the past decade.
100% of recorded transactions in the area were for detached properties.
Housing in WS7 9QG is predominantly owner-occupied, with an estimated 90% of homes being lived in by the owners.
Properties at WS7 9QG appear eighty-seven times in the Land Registry records, with the latest transaction recorded on 5 Jul 2024. It also has thirty-two Energy Performance Certificates (EPC) entries, the earliest dating back to 10 Dec 2014. We use this data, to estimate the property's characteristics and current market value.
